Established in 1983, the NC State Veterinary Hospital (VH) is one of the nation's highest-rated academic medical centers, serving North Carolina and the surrounding region. The VH treats nearly 35,000 patients annually across more than 20 clinical services, utilizing a team-based approach that leverages the expertise of nationally and internationally renowned board-certified specialists.
The VH is dedicated to:
- Clinical Excellence: Providing compassionate, state-of-the-art specialty healthcare at the cutting edge of veterinary medicine.
- Education: Delivering expert clinical instruction to fourth-year veterinary students from the College of Veterinary Medicine.
- Innovation: Advancing the field through the ongoing investigation of innovative techniques and medical procedures.

Essential Job Duties
The Equine and Farm Animal Attendant provides essential, high-quality animal husbandry and environmental support for all patients at the Equine and Farm Animal Veterinary Center. This role is hands-on and requires a dedicated individual to assist with the daily care, feeding, and handling of a varied patient population-including equine, bovine, caprine, ovine, and camelid species. Additionally, this position is critical to maintaining a sterile, safe, and fully stocked hospital environment, ensuring compliance with strict infectious disease protocols, and supporting overall hospital operations.
Key Responsibilities
- Direct Patient Care & Husbandry
- Provide daily care for veterinary patients, including feeding, watering, grooming, and monitoring.
- Safely handle and restrain various large animal species (horses, cattle, goats, sheep, alpacas/llamas) for clinical procedures.
- Observe and report any changes in patient behavior, appetite, or physical condition to the veterinary medical team.
- Facility Cleanliness & Sanitation
- Adhere strictly to established hospital protocols to maintain a clean, sterile, and sanitary environment.
- Clean and strip stalls, and disinfect all clinical, treatment, and housing areas of the hospital.
- Manage waste removal, laundry, and general sanitation tasks.
- Rigidly follow and enforce all Infectious Disease and Biosecurity protocols to prevent cross-contamination.
